What is A4 Paper?
A4 Paper In Packs paper is defined by its dimensions of 210 x 297 mm (8.27 x 11.69 inches) and becomes part of the ISO 216 requirement. It is widely utilized for printing, copying, and composing in numerous parts of the world, especially in Europe and Asia. The versatility of A4 paper makes it a favored choice for companies, universities, and individual use.

When choosing A4 paper, one need to think about numerous types, each serving specific requirements. Below is a list of the most common types:
Standard Copy Paper: Ideal for daily usage such as printing and copying. Typically readily available in weights varying from 70 to 90 gsm (grams per square meter).
Premium Paper: A higher quality alternative for presentations and professional documents, typically weighing 100 gsm or more.
Image Paper: Designed particularly for printing photographs, providing a shiny finish and greater weight (as much as 250 gsm).
Recycled Paper: An environmentally friendly option made from recycled products, available in various weights and finishes.
Colored Paper: Available in numerous hues and surfaces, excellent for imaginative tasks or to highlight crucial documents.
Comprehending Paper Weight
The weight of paper (gsm) indicates the density and sturdiness:

A1: A weight of 75-90 gsm is perfect for daily printing and copying jobs.
Q2: Can I use A4 paper in any printer?
A2: Yes, A4 paper is compatible with most printers, though some printers may have size restrictions.
Q3: Is recycled A4 paper of good quality?
A3: Yes, recycled A4 paper can provide high quality comparable to non-recycled paper, depending upon the brand name and manufacturing process.
Q4: What's the difference between shiny and matte surfaces?
A4 paper with a glossy finish has a shiny surface area that boosts color vibrancy, making it perfect for images. Matte finish, on the other hand, offers a non-reflective surface, making it suitable for text-heavy documents.
Q5: Can A4 paper be used for crafts?
A5: Absolutely! A4 paper is flexible, and numerous types can be utilized for crafts, including colored and textured choices.
